## Authentication

The Corvet driver-assignment heuristic runs as an internal service. All requests require bearer auth; tokens rotate every 12 hours via the Halden vault. No anonymous reads. Assignment overrides are logged with caller identity. Reviewers verifying the audit trail should call the staging endpoint using the token below.

session JWT of yawep-yawep = eyJhbGciOiJIUzI1NiIsInR5cCI6IkpXVCJ9.eyJzdWIiOiI3pWF3_In0.aXYsHiog

Scope: the Quillport parity checker polls partner rate feeds and flags mismatches. Security-relevant bits: outbound requests are capped per host, TLS-only, and responses over the size limit are dropped unscanned — review whether that's acceptable. Credentials rotate via the vault hook; nothing is logged above the hash prefix. Backoff and concurrency caps bound blast radius if a feed misbehaves. The enforcement constants are defined as follows:

tuning table, yajog-yahof:
BUDGETS = {
    "lamvan": 303,
    "wenox": 460,
    "fenvan": 525,
}

## Runbook — Timeweave Solver Release (fragment)

After the solver passes the constraint regression suite, tag the build and push to the staging registry. New folks: never skip the feasibility smoke test, even for patch releases — schools notice broken timetables immediately. Sign the release artifact before promotion using the key below.

release key, hafop-hafog: bky4_vbsR

## Deploying the Gatewick Proctor Queue

Deploys are pretty painless: push to main, wait for the pipeline, then watch the queue drain dashboard for five minutes. If candidates pile up mid-exam, roll back first and ask questions later — the queue replays safely. Everything the workers care about lives in one config block, shown here for reference.

settings of bafof-yagef:
JOROX_PIN=8740
JOROX_TENANT=pelox
JOROX_METRICS_HOST=metrics.jorox.qorvelworks.internal
JOROX_SEAL=seal_c78f63c1
JOROX_STANDBY_TEAM=norax